Types of External Fixator Instruments Set
External fixator instruments sets come in various configurations to cater to different surgical needs. Understanding the types available can help surgeons select the most appropriate set for their specific cases.
- Unilateral External Fixators: Commonly used for simple fractures, this type provides support from one side and is easier to apply.
- Ilizarov Apparatus: A complex external fixator that allows advanced bone lengthening and deformity correction, widely recognized for its effectiveness.
- Bilateral External Fixators: Offering support from both sides, these are ideal for more complex fractures or when additional stabilization is required.
- Hybrid Fixators: These combine both internal and external elements, allowing for versatile treatment options and tailored approaches.

Applications of External Fixator Instruments Set
The applications of the external fixator instruments set are vast and varied, making it a crucial tool in orthopedic practices.
- Fracture Management: Extensively used for stabilizing various fracture types, particularly in the extremities.
- Deformity Correction: Employed in procedures aiming to correct limb deformities and length discrepancies.
- Bone Transport: Utilized in conjunction with the Ilizarov technique for bone regeneration and transport in defect management.
- Trauma Surgery: Essential in emergency and trauma surgeries where immediate stabilization is necessary to prevent further injury.
